From d08bd5e10e114ce55a8be051a9ef5680b63ca9cf Mon Sep 17 00:00:00 2001 From: Ggysh-7 <102372376+Ggysh-7@users.noreply.github.com> Date: Sun, 13 Nov 2022 14:56:16 +0800 Subject: [PATCH] =?UTF-8?q?feaet:=E6=8A=95=E7=A5=A8=E9=A2=98=E5=B9=B2?= =?UTF-8?q?=E5=88=A0=E9=99=A4=E3=80=81=E9=80=89=E9=A1=B9=E5=88=A0=E9=99=A4?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/components/drawers/CreVote.vue | 35 ++++++++++++++++++++---------- 1 file changed, 24 insertions(+), 11 deletions(-) diff --git a/src/components/drawers/CreVote.vue b/src/components/drawers/CreVote.vue index cdcd309d..0158a5ed 100644 --- a/src/components/drawers/CreVote.vue +++ b/src/components/drawers/CreVote.vue @@ -36,7 +36,7 @@
-
+
删除题干
@@ -77,10 +77,18 @@ v-model:value="o.opvalue" style="width: 424px; height: 32px" /> -
+ + 上传图片
@@ -154,7 +162,11 @@ export default { }, ], }); - }; + }; + const delQue = (value,index)=>{ + console.log('gyd',value,index); + value.splice(value[index],1) + } const addOpt = (value) => { console.log(value); value.push({ @@ -163,10 +175,10 @@ export default { opvalue: "", }); }; - const delOpt = (value) => { - console.log('gys', value); - // delete value[0] - value.pop() + const delOpt = (value,index) => { + console.log('gys', value,index); + // delete value + value.splice(value[index],1) } const closeDrawer = () => { @@ -186,10 +198,10 @@ export default { // message.destroy(); // return message.info("请输入题干"); // } - // if (!state.questions.optins.opvalue) { - // message.destroy(); - // return message.info("请输入选项"); - // } + if (!state.questions.optins.opvalue) { + message.destroy(); + return message.info("请输入选项"); + } console.log("111111", state.questions); // console.log('22222',state.questions.inputV); // console.log('333333',state.questions.options); @@ -258,6 +270,7 @@ export default { afterVisibleChange, closeDrawer, addQue, + delQue, addOpt, delOpt, createQueTit,